Is Country View Estates Safe?
Yes — this neighborhood is extremely safe. Country View Estates in Harrison, OH has a safety grade of A+. The overall crime index is 61, which is 39% below the national average of 100.
Compared to the Harrison average (crime index 177), Country View Estates is 116% lower in overall crime. This neighborhood is significantly safer than Harrison as a whole, making it an attractive option for safety-conscious residents.
Looking at specific crime types, robbery is the most elevated concern (index: 157, 57% above average), while assault is the lowest risk (index: 15). Violent crime is a particular area of concern relative to property crime in this neighborhood.
